核壳丙烯酸酯乳液的合成及其涂料耐沾污性研究 被引量:4

Investigation on copolymerization of core-shell acrylate emulsion and stain resistance of latex coating

摘要 分析了丙烯酸酯乳胶粒子的类型,壳层中交联单体、有机氟单体、有机硅单体等掺量和核壳乳液聚合中可聚合乳化剂用量对丙烯酸酯外墙乳胶涂料耐沾污性的影响。结果表明,内软外硬型核壳乳液的壳层中掺入适量交联单体、有机氟单体、有机硅单体,核壳乳液聚合中掺入适量可聚合乳化剂,有利于丙烯酸酯核壳乳胶涂料耐沾污性的提高。 The effect of acrylate latex particle typo, quantity of cross-linking monomer, organo-fluorine monomer and organosilicon monomer mixed into the shell,dosage of polymerisable emulsifier in polymerization of core-shell emulsion on stain resistance of acrylate emulsion coating for exterior wall are analyzed. Result shows:mixing proper amount of cross-linking monomer, organo-fluorine monomer and organosilicon monomer into soft inside and hard outside shell of core-shell emulsion,and adding proper amount of polymerisable emulsifier in polymerization of core-shell emulsion are favourable to improve stain resistance of core-shell acrylate emulsion coating.
